The length of a rectangle is three more than its width. The perimeter is 86cm. Find the length and width of the rectangle. Write
elena-s [515]
P=2(l+w)
Substitute width plus 3 for length
Remember order of operations: multiply before adding

86=2((w+3) + w)
86=2w+6+2w
86=4w+6
80=4w
20=w
23=w+3=l

Check the answer
86=2((w+3) + w)
86=2((20+3)+20
86=2(23+20)
86=46+40
86=86

27.1% of city employees ride the bus to work. This is up 47% from last year. What percent of employees rode the bus to work last
dolphi86 [110]

Answer:

18.44%

Step-by-step explanation:

Let :

Percentage who rode bus to work last year = x

Percentage who ride bus to work this year = 27.1%

Percentage who ride bus to work this year = [percentage who rode bus to work last year + 47% of percentage who rode bus to work last year]

Mathematically ;

27.1% = x + 47% of x

0.271 = x + (0.47x)

0.271 = x + 0.47x

0.271 = 1.47x

x = 0.271 / 1.47

x = 0.1843537

x = 0.1843537 * 100%

x = 18.435%

x = 18.44%
